Player News (last updated: November 22, 2009)
News: Harrison had three tackles, a sack and a fumble recovery in Sunday's loss to the Chiefs.
Spin: Harrison's take-down of Matt Cassel was his 10th sack of the season, giving him double-digit sacks for the second straight season. Only Denver's Elvis Dumervil has more sacks among linebackers (12).
